CVE-2017-17672

50
FAUCET Score

CVE-2017-17672 is a critical unauthenticated deserialization vulnerability affecting vBulletin through version 5.3.x. It allows remote attackers to achieve arbitrary file deletion and, in some cases, remote code execution due to unsafe use of PHP's unserialize() function within the publicly exposed cacheTemplates() API. With a CVSS score of 9.8 (Critical), this vulnerability has a low attack complexity and requires no user interaction, enabling full comp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ability. While not listed on CISA's KEV catalog, exploit code is publicly available on ExploitDB, and it has garnered significant community discussion and media coverage.
